{"id":1339,"date":"2022-06-22T09:21:09","date_gmt":"2022-06-22T06:21:09","guid":{"rendered":"https:\/\/finoko.info\/?page_id=1339"},"modified":"2026-07-25T11:07:29","modified_gmt":"2026-07-25T08:07:29","slug":"fashion-retail","status":"publish","type":"page","link":"https:\/\/retailbi.info\/en\/retail-formats\/fashion-retail\/","title":{"rendered":"Retail BI for fashion store"},"content":{"rendered":"\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Fashion retail requires a much more specialised analytical approach than many other retail formats. Performance depends not only on category-level demand, but also on model, size, colour, collection, season, and product life cycle stage. A retailer may report solid turnover and still lose margin because of overstocks, weak size distribution, poor buying depth, ineffective markdown strategy, or an assortment structure that does not match actual customer demand.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">That is why retail BI for fashion retail must go beyond standard sales reporting. It should help management understand what is happening inside collections and product matrices, not just at the level of total revenue. Instead of relying on fragmented reports from separate systems, the company gains a single analytical space where it can monitor current collection performance, detect deviations earlier, and manage the business more systematically.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Why fashion retail needs specialised BI<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Fashion retail is highly sensitive to seasonal timing and assortment quality. If a collection is bought too deep, if the size curve does not reflect real demand, or if a model remains on the shop floor too long without movement, the business quickly faces excess stock, higher markdown pressure, and weaker profitability. In many cases, traditional reporting only shows overall results by store or category, but does not reveal which exact products are creating the problem.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Retail BI makes these weak points visible. It shows which models and collections genuinely support sales, where slower sizes or colours are accumulating, which product groups need earlier review, and how discount activity is affecting the financial result. This is especially important for fashion chains with a broad assortment matrix, where manual control and simple summary reports are no longer enough.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Another common issue in fashion retail is that high turnover can conceal deterioration in sales quality. Strong promotional activity, frequent discounting, and rapid stock clearance may temporarily support revenue, while at the same time reducing gross profit and weakening the economics of the collection. Retail BI helps management detect these effects as part of routine control rather than after the season is already lost.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">What capabilities matter most in retail BI for fashion retail<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">For this format, one of the most important capabilities is multi-dimensional sales analysis. A fashion retailer needs to evaluate results by store, collection, category, model, brand, size, colour, and SKU. This makes it possible to understand which areas are genuinely performing well, where demand structure is changing, and which items need management attention. In fashion, the difference between a strong and weak season is often determined not only by product group, but by specific models inside the collection.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Inventory control is equally critical. In fashion retail, excess stock rapidly turns into future markdowns and margin pressure, while shortages in popular models, sizes, or colours lead directly to lost sales. Retail BI supports stock visibility at collection and SKU level, highlights slow-moving items, reveals imbalances in size curves, and helps assess whether stockholding reflects real demand patterns.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Profit and margin analysis is also central. Different categories and collections contribute differently to the financial result, and markdown policies can sharply alter actual profitability. A strong BI system allows the company to assess gross profit, margin rate, markdown impact, and the contribution of each assortment direction, so that management can steer not only turnover, but also quality of earnings.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">ABC analysis and assortment analysis play a major role as well. In fashion retail, management needs to know which models form the commercial core, which items strengthen assortment depth, and which products create unnecessary stock burden. BI makes it easier to identify strong collections, detect weak parts of the matrix, and take more accurate decisions about buying, markdowns, replenishment, and store redistribution. Plan-versus-actual analysis and management dashboards are also highly valuable because they help teams control key KPIs and respond faster to deviations.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Key metrics for fashion retail BI<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">The following metrics are especially important when building retail BI for fashion retail: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Revenue<\/strong> shows the total sales volume and helps assess business dynamics by store, collection, category, and period.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Number of transactions<\/strong> reflects customer traffic and helps identify changes in shopping activity across stores or regions.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Average transaction value<\/strong> shows the average basket size and helps evaluate sales quality and customer purchasing behaviour.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Sales by collection<\/strong> reveal which collections are driving the season and how their role changes over time.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Sales by model<\/strong> help identify strong and weak products inside each category and support better assortment decisions.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Sales by size<\/strong> show whether the size structure matches real customer demand.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Sales by colour<\/strong> help evaluate customer preferences and improve buying depth by variant.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Sell-through<\/strong> shows what share of a collection or model has already been sold and helps assess buying quality and sales speed.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Gross profit<\/strong> reflects the financial result before operating expenses and helps assess the quality of revenue.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Margin rate<\/strong> shows the profitability level of categories, collections, and individual models.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Inventory on hand<\/strong> provides visibility over current stock volume and its fit with the stage of the season.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Inventory turnover<\/strong> shows how quickly stock is moving through the business and how efficiently working capital is being used.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Slow-moving stock<\/strong> highlights models, sizes, or colours that create future markdown risk.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Share of markdown sales<\/strong> shows how much of revenue is generated through discounted products.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Average discount level<\/strong> helps assess how strongly discounting is influencing both demand and profitability.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>ABC analysis of products<\/strong> identifies the items generating the largest share of turnover or profit.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Collection efficiency<\/strong> shows which collections combine strong sales, healthy profitability, and acceptable stock exit speed.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Store efficiency<\/strong> helps compare locations and identify the strongest and weakest stores in the network.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Plan versus actual sales<\/strong> shows whether the current result is aligned with seasonal, collection, or store targets.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Plan versus actual profit<\/strong> helps management control target profitability rather than focusing only on turnover.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">How retail BI improves fashion retail performance<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">The practical value of retail BI lies in making the fashion business more transparent and manageable. The company can understand the relationship between collections, sales, inventory, discounting, and profit instead of analysing these areas separately. This improves the quality and speed of decisions related to purchasing, collection management, markdown strategy, size depth, and stock reallocation between stores.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">For a fashion retailer operating in Europe, this can be especially valuable when managing multiple locations across city centres, shopping centres, outlet formats, and e-commerce channels. Differences in demand between markets such as Romania, Poland, Germany, Italy, or the Baltic states may significantly affect size structure, colour preferences, and promotional sensitivity. A proper BI environment helps management detect these differences quickly and respond with more precision.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">The business effect is visible in several directions: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>lower risk of overstock and residual stock accumulation<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>better visibility into weak models, sizes, and colours<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>stronger control over markdown activity and its effect on margins<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>clearer understanding of which collections truly support profit, not just revenue<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>better alignment between commercial, buying, finance, and store operations teams<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">This alignment is particularly important in fashion retail because assortment decisions have a direct impact on seasonal performance.
